Sichere Kommunikation
Nun schauen wir uns an wie die Herstellung einer sicheren Verbindung von statten geht. Der Ablauf einer typischen, sicheren Kommunikation zwischen Client und Server sieht folgendermassen aus:
- Verbindungsaufnahme des Clients
- Authentifizierung des Server
- Authentifizierung des Clients
- Datentransfer
- Verbindungsabbruch
Def: Asymmetrische Verschlüsselung Bei der Verschlüsselung werden zwei Schlüssel generiert, ein privater und ein geheimer. Dabei kann nur ein passender, privater Schlüssel Daten entschlüsseln, die mit dem öffentliche Schlüssel codiert wurden und umgekehrt.
|